IT Infrastructure Architect

Purpose:

This position proactively and holistically leads and support architecture activities that guide the development and management of solutions, as well as provide the leadership, facilitation, analysis, and conceptual and logical design tasks required for the development of the domain area. Translating department and technical requirements into architectural blueprints and documenting all solution architecture design and analysis are critical to ensure City IT products and solutions meet the needs of constituents and align to a strategy that will prepare the city for future success.

Notes to Candidate:

Austin Energy (AE) seeks an IT Infrastructure Architect to provide systems support for the Technology and Data (IT) Infrastructure team. This position provides 24/7 on-call Data Center Operations support for Austin Energy's Technology and Data Division.

This position provides advanced administration and technical support to servers, storage area networks, backup environment, AppViewX, and NERC cyber security. This position collaborates with clients to ensure appropriate IT resources are provided to meet business needs in compliance with NERC/CIP and other mandated standards.
